Signals

These are separate measurements of different things. They are deliberately not combined into one score, because a popularity number that mixes website traffic with saves and stars cannot be checked or acted on.

Signal Value What it measures Window Observed Source
GitHub stars 393 Number of GitHub accounts that bookmarked this repository since it was created. It is a bookmark count, not installs, not active users and not quality. cumulative, all time GitHub
Last commit 2026-08-02 Date of the most recent push to any branch. This is the strongest cheap indicator of whether the project is still maintained. point in time GitHub
Open issues 14 Open issues plus open pull requests, as GitHub counts them together. A high number can mean an active project or an abandoned one. as of fetch GitHub
Latest published version 0.4.13 Latest version string the maintainer published to the registry. as of fetch Model Context Protocol
Registry record last updated 2026-05-03 When the registry record was last updated by its maintainer. point in time Model Context Protocol
License MIT Licence GitHub detected in the repository. Detection can be wrong; the LICENSE file is authoritative. as of fetch GitHub
First listed in the MCP Registry 2026-05-03 Date this server was first published to the official MCP Registry. Not a usage or quality measure. point in time Model Context Protocol
repository status active The repository exists on GitHub and is not archived. This says nothing about how recently it was worked on. as of fetch GitHub
